# Retell AI SDK Patterns ## Overview Production-ready patterns for Retell AI SDK usage in TypeScript and Python. ## Prerequisites - Completed `retellai-install-auth` setup - Familiarity with async/await patterns - Understanding of error handling best practices ## Instructions ### Step 1: Implement Singleton Pattern (Recommended) ```typescript // src/retellai/client.ts import { RetellAIClient } from '@retellai/sdk'; let instance: RetellAIClient | null = null; export function getRetell AIClient(): RetellAIClient { if (!instance) { instance = new RetellAIClient({ apiKey: process.env.RETELLAI_API_KEY!, // Additional options }); } return instance; } ``` ### Step 2: Add Error Handling Wrapper ```typescript import { Retell AIError } from '@retellai/sdk'; async function safeRetell AICall( operation: () => Promise ): Promise<{ data: T | null; error: Error | null }> { try { const data = await operation(); return { data, error: null }; } catch (err) { if (err instanceof Retell AIError) { console.error({ code: err.code, message: err.message, }); } return { data: null, error: err as Error }; } } ``` ### Step 3: Implement Retry Logic ```typescript async function withRetry( operation: () => Promise, maxRetries = 3, backoffMs = 1000 ): Promise { for (let attempt = 1; attempt <= maxRetries; attempt++) { try { return await operation(); } catch (err) { if (attempt === maxRetries) throw err; const delay = backoffMs * Math.pow(2, attempt - 1); await new Promise(r => setTimeout(r, delay)); } } throw new Error('Unreachable'); } ``` ## Output - Type-safe client singleton - Robust error handling with structured logging - Automatic retry with exponential backoff - Runtime validation for API responses ## Error Handling | Pattern | Use Case | Benefit | |---------|----------|---------| | Safe wrapper | All API calls | Prevents uncaught exceptions | | Retry logic | Transient failures | Improves reliability | | Type guards | Response validation | Catches API changes | | Logging | All operations | Debugging and monitoring | ## Examples ### Factory Pattern (Multi-tenant) ```typescript const clients = new Map(); export function getClientForTenant(tenantId: string): RetellAIClient { if (!clients.has(tenantId)) { const apiKey = getTenantApiKey(tenantId); clients.set(tenantId, new RetellAIClient({ apiKey })); } return clients.get(tenantId)!; } ``` ### Python Context Manager ```python from contextlib import asynccontextmanager from retellai import RetellAIClient @asynccontextmanager async def get_retellai_client(): client = RetellAIClient() try: yield client finally: await client.close() ``` ### Zod Validation ```typescript import { z } from 'zod'; const retellaiResponseSchema = z.object({ id: z.string(), status: z.enum(['active', 'inactive']), createdAt: z.string().datetime(), }); ``` ## Resources - [Retell AI SDK Reference](https://docs.retellai.com/sdk) - [Retell AI API Types](https://docs.retellai.com/types) - [Zod Documentation](https://zod.dev/) ## Next Steps Apply patterns in `retellai-core-workflow-a` for real-world usage.
